Dyscalculia is a neurodevelopmental learning difficulty impairing numerical understanding and calculation, distinct from poor instruction or low intelligence. It manifests in number sense, arithmetic, and spatial-numerical tasks, often co-occurs with other conditions, and benefits from early diagnosis, targeted teaching, accommodations, and assistive technology.
